cloud computing
DESCRIPTION
TRANSCRIPT
1
Réalisé Par:
Amine Ben Jemâa
13/12/ 2011
Cloud
Cloud Computing
2
Plan
• Definition
• Historique
• Cloud Computingo types o modèles de déploiemento Caractéristiqueso Avantageso Inconvénients
• Conclusion
Cloud
3
Le Cloud Computing ou « informatique dans le nuage » désigne une forme d’architecture informatique dans laquelle les ressources, qu’elles soient matérielles ou
logicielles, sont partagées sur le réseau.
Qu’est-ce que leCLOUD COMPUTING?
4
Cloud
Historique de Cloud Computing
Le concept du Cloud Computing a été inventé en 2002
par Amazon, qui avait investi dans un parc de machines
immense, dimensionné pour absorber la charge
importante des commandes faites sur leur site au
moment des fêtes de Noël, mais plutôt inutilisé le reste
de l’année.
Leur idée a donc été d’ouvrir toutes ces ressources
inutilisées aux entreprises, pour qu’elles les louent à la
demande.
5
Quoi de neuf?
Acquisition Model: Based on purchasing of services
Business Model: Based on pay for use
Access Model: Over the Internet to ANY device
Technical Model: Scalable, elastic, dynamic, multi-tenant, & sharable
Cloud
6
Caractéristiques de Cloud
On-Demand Self Service
Broad Network Access
Resource Pooling
Rapid ElasticityMeasured Service
Cloud
7
Cloud Service Models(1)
• Cloud Software as a Service (SaaS)
Le matériel, l'hébergement, le framework d'application et le logiciel sont dématérialisés. Il consiste à proposer des applications en tant que services accessibles par Internet. Les applications ne sont donc plus acquises sous forme de licences mais louées à la demande, en fonction des besoins de l’entreprise.
• Cloud Platform as a Service (PaaS)
Les plateformes sont proposées en tant que services, sur lesquels, il est possible de développer, tester et déployer des applications.
To be considered “cloud” services are deployed on top of cloud infrastructure that has the key characteristics
Software as a Service (SaaS)
Platform as a Service (PaaS)
Infrastucture as a Service (IaaS)
Cloud
8
Cloud Service Models(2)
• Cloud Infrastructure as a Service (IaaS)
Seule de matériel (serveurs) est dématérialisé. Les ressources matérielles sont proposées en tant que services, notamment pour le stockage, les composants réseaux ou encore la puissance de calcul.
Software as a Service (SaaS)
Platform as a Service (PaaS)
Infrastucture as a Service (IaaS)
Cloud
9
Modèles de déploiement cloud(1)
• Les Clouds privés
- sont exploités exclusivement par une organisation en
particulier.
• Les Clouds publics
- sont ouverts à l’ensemble du public ou à un grand groupe
industriel et sont exploités et dirigés par un
fournisseur de services de Cloud.
Public Private Hybrid Community
10
Modèles de déploiement cloud(2)
• Les Clouds communautaires
- offrent une infrastructure qui est partagée par plusieurs
organisations et prend en charge une communauté
spécifique.
• Les Clouds hybrides
- regroupent deux Clouds ou plus (privés ou publics)
Public Private Hybrid Community
11
Les avantages du Cloud Computing (1/3)
Source: IBSG 2009
12
Les avantages du Cloud Computing (2/3)
Source: IBSG 2009
13
Les avantages du Cloud Computing (3/3)
Source: IBSG 2009
• Le budget : Le Cloud Computing permet une meilleure
gestion budgétaire car on paie selon la quantité de
données et le temps de traitement qu’on utilise. Donc
on évite les dépenses inutiles en acquisition de logiciels,
de licences d’exploitation (nécessaires pour utiliser les
logiciels payants), de matériels…
1414
• La connexion : Si la connexion Internet est défaillante,
il est impossible d’accéder aux ressources stockées à
distance.
• Sécurité : la plateforme cloud, si elle est externe, elle
doit être suffisamment sécurisée pour éviter le risque
d’intrusion, de vol des données par piratage. L’autre
risque est qu’un utilisateur oublie de se déconnecter
sur un appareil accessible par des éléments externes à
l’organisation.
Les inconvénients du Cloud Computing
1515
http://www.youtube.com/watch?v=HF1hryPHj_Y
CloudDémonstration vidéo
16
Conclusion
• Le Cloud computing est un concept de déportation sur
des serveurs distants des traitements informatiques
traditionnellement localisés sur le poste utilisateur. L’idée
est de déporter le traitement sur un serveur externalisé.
Plus besoin d’installer le logiciel en local sur chaque
poste, les fonctionnalités utiles pour l’entreprise se
retrouvent toutes en ligne ou sur un serveur interne.
17
Références
http://www.salesforce.com/fr/cloudcomputing/#more
http://lexpansion.lexpress.fr/high-tech/le-cloud-computing-explique-aux-nuls_248693.html
http://www.authsecu.com/cloud-computing-bonnes-pratiques/cloud-computing-bonnes-pratiques.php
http://www.protegez-vos-donnees.fr/protections/cloud-computing-externalisez-vos-ressources-numeriques.php
18
Merci